Motion · S5M-20129 · 3 Dec 2019
Asda Alloa
The motion
That the Parliament congratulates Asda Alloa on its fundraising efforts; notes that seven members of its staff recently completed a sponsored walk that raised £700 for Forth Valley Royal Hospital and that 80 organised an event, with raffles and fundraising games, which collected £286 towards Cash for Kids; acknowledges that, as part of the quarterly Green Token Giving Programme, which is voted for by its customers and funded by the Asda Foundation, the store donated £500 to Redwell Primary School, with £200 each going to Stirling County Rugby Football Club and the charity, the Butterfly Day Centre, and commends all of the staff and customers involved with this fundraising for their extremely magnanimous and benevolent work.
